Medium | GrooveSquid.com (original content) | Medium Difficulty Summary This study develops a novel method for integrating Large Language Models into healthcare diagnostics. The approach involves using structured prompts to integrate medical domain knowledge, enabling zero-shot/few-shot in-context learning. Two communication styles are explored: Numerical Conversational (NC) and Natural Language Single-Turn (NL-ST). The NC style processes data incrementally, while the NL-ST style uses long narrative prompts. |
